A wedding day isn’t just about the bride’s stunning moments—it’s also a celebration of the groom and his closest friends and family. As the groom and his wedding party share in the excitement, their genuine camaraderie and unique style deserve to be captured beautifully. Here are some creative photo ideas and tips to ensure that every memorable moment with the groom and his crew is documented perfectly:
1. Classic Candid Moments
While posed shots are timeless, candid moments often tell the real story of the day. I encourage the groom and their party to relax, share a laugh, and be themselves. Whether it’s a spontaneous high-five, a shared joke while waiting for the ceremony, or a quiet moment of reflection before the big event, these genuine interactions make for unforgettable images.
2. The Groom’s Portrait
I always remember to capture a few dedicated portraits for the groom, to highlight his personality with a mix of formal and relaxed poses. Consider using natural settings around your venue or even a cool urban backdrop if your style leans modern. These images will not only reflect his unique style but also provide a timeless keepsake of his journey to “I do.”
3. Group Shots with a Twist
For the wedding party group shots, mix it up a bit. Instead of the traditional line-up, try:
Dynamic Poses: Have the group staggered in height or create playful formations like a circle or diagonal lineup.
Action Shots: Capture the party walking together, laughing during a quick toast, or even interacting naturally during a moment of excitement. These action shots add energy and vibrancy to your album.
Detail Focus: Include creative close-ups of the groom’s cufflinks, his boutonniere, or the unique elements of his attire. These detail shots can bring a unique edge to the overall story of your wedding day.
4. The “Pre-Ceremony” Energy
Some of the best images come from behind-the-scenes moments before the ceremony. Photograph the groom and his party as they prepare, share a toast, or enjoy a light-hearted moment together. These photos capture the anticipation, camaraderie, and excitement of what’s to come.
5. A Touch of Personalization
Every groom is unique, so consider incorporating personal elements that showcase his interests or style. Whether it’s a favorite accessory, a meaningful piece of jewelry, or even a location that’s special to the group, adding these touches will make the images feel authentic and memorable.
6. Lighting & Location Magic
Utilize natural lighting, especially during golden hour, to create dramatic and flattering portraits. Whether you choose an urban setting, a rustic venue, or an outdoor area with lush greenery, the right light and location can transform your group photos into stunning works of art.
